Anthony Paul "Tony" McCarthy (born 9 November 1969) is an Irish retired footballer who is currently the physiotherapist at Shamrock Rovers.
[1] Tony started his League of Ireland career with University College Dublin in 1987.
After two seasons, he transferred to Derry City where he gained two further U21 caps.
His one season at Tolka Park was a huge success as Shels won the League of Ireland [2], Tony was named PFAI Young Player of the Year.
Tony completed a move across the channel to Millwall FC in 1992, scoring on his debut and picking up the Man of the Match award.
